Narrative: It's February and time to paddle. The water is dropping, and the winter is weakening its grip on our kayaks This Saturday looks like a good day to paddle. We will meet at the Sauvie Island Boat Ramp and paddle over to Kelley Point Park. This is about 12 miles round trip. The group will pass by the house boats on the Multnomah channel. Then we will go by some of the ships loading freight out on the Willamette before landing on the shore of Kelley Point Park for lunch.
Sauvie Island Boat ramp has a toilet and free parking. Parking is on the shoulder of the road.
